Jerry Christopher Evans

Ronceverte-Jerry Christopher “Chris” Evans, 59, passed away Dec. 9, 2023, in Roanoke Memorial Hospital.

He was born July 12, 1964, in Montgomery, WV, the son of the late Jack G. and Audrey Kincaid Evans.

Chris was a locomotive engineer with CSX Railroad, having worked with them for 28 years. He attended Trinity United Methodist Church in Ronceverte and he had attended WV Tech.

Other than his parents he was preceded in death by siblings, Jeffrey Evans and Terry Evans.

Those left to cherish his memory are his wife, Cindy Sampson Evans; sons,  Justin Martin (Trista) of Ronceverte and Harrison Martin (Hailey) of Waverly, WV; grandson, Jamesin Hurley of Waverly; siblings, Jack Evans, Jr. (Sally) of Faber, VA, Ann E. Blake (Mike) of Deland, FL, Kevin Evans (Maria) of Edgewater, FL, and Jennifer Allen; and his special furbabies, Cooper and Otis.

Funeral services for Chris will be Saturday Dec. 16, at 2 p.m. at the Wallace & Wallace Funeral Home in Lewisburg with Pastor Mark Shafer officiating. Interment will follow in Greenbrier Memorial Gardens, Lewisburg. The family will receive family and friends from 12 noon until 2 p.m. at the funeral home.

Chris’ love of children and in some way to make it better for the children it seems appropriate that in  lieu of flowers memorial contributions should be made in his memory to either: The Children’s Home Society, 9579 Seneca Trail South, Lewisburg, WV 24901 or to the Ronceverte Lions Club Youth Basketball Program, 212 Monroe Avenue, Ronceverte, WV 24970.

Wallace & Wallace Funeral Home in Lewisburg is in charge of arrangements. Please send online condolences by visiting www.WallaceandWallaceFH.com.
